从数据库中读取数据到试图函数里,一定导入模型
时间: 2024-10-11 16:09:40 浏览: 24
【知识图谱构建】从Mysql读取数据批量导入到Neo4j图数据库中
在Python的Django或Flask等Web开发框架中,如果你需要将数据库的数据映射到视图(view)函数并展示给用户,通常会使用ORM(Object-Relational Mapping),比如Django ORM。在导入模型(model)之前,你需要先安装相应的库,并创建或引用数据库中的表结构。
例如,在Django中:
```python
from django.db import models
from .models import YourModel # 这里的YourModel是你定义的数据库模型
def your_view(request):
queryset = YourModel.objects.all() # 查询所有记录
for item in queryset:
# 将查询结果转化为视图层可以处理的对象
data_to_display = item.some_field_data
# 然后在这里处理数据并渲染到模板中
```
在Flask-SQLAlchemy或其他SQLAlchemy兼容库中:
```python
from flask_sqlalchemy import SQLAlchemy
db = SQLAlchemy()
class YourModel(db.Model): # 类似于Django的模型定义
...
def your_view():
items = YourModel.query.all() # 查询数据
for item in items:
data_to_display = item.field_name
# ...后续处理
```
阅读全文